  • Beware, OPDs. Other People's Dreams.
  • I am all for helping others. I am all for engaging in other people's projects - with awareness. But I think there's a danger in (myself and many of my helper-type peers) becoming so consumed with someone else's dream that we forget to pursue our own. That's one reason you may benefit from doing this sort of work twice a year at least.

12 More Ways to Spot IT Lies and Omissions in Due Diligence - MakingITclear® - 0 views

  • The current solution doesn’t scale up
  • The current solution doesn’t scale down
  • The seller is evasive on version numbers and specific types of hardware and software
  • ...9 more annotations...
  • The number of people in an area doesn’t make sense
  • Omitted business functions
  • Customer list doesn’t match revenue
  • Lack of clarity around ownership of rights
  • Informal subcontractors
  • Person who did the work is no longer with the company
  • There is no (or not enough) budget for maintenance and replacement of equipment
  • No contingency or disaster plan
  • Lost in technology translation
